About Catalysis Research Group

Catalysis is the key technology in the oil and gas downstream industries. UBD’s Catalysis Research Group aims for new innovative technologies and catalyst products for the development of oil and gas downstream industries in Brunei. Furthermore, the Catalysis Research Group brings together research experts for more collaborative and focussed research areas, manpower training and building up research facilities for catalysis research.

At present, the group has built strong collaboration across the science and engineering faculties and research centres in UBD and also world-leading catalysis research experts from UK (Oxford University and Cardiff University), Hong Kong (Hong Kong Polytechnic University and City University of Hong Kong), China (Xiamen University and Beijing University of Chemical Technologies) and Singapore (National University of Singapore and Nanyang Technological University). Through our research activities, we have developed catalyst products which shows promising efficiency towards processes involved in natural gas downstream industries and have engaged relevant stakeholders for the commercialisation of the products.

In addition to the oil and gas downstream industries, the Catalysis Research Group is also focussing on developing green and carbon-neural technologies such as green hydrogen production and storage and carbon capture and utilisation.
